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)

Voorhees CDP (Somerset County) violent crime is 12.0. (The US average is 22.7)
Voorhees CDP (Somerset County) property crime is 40.1. (The US average is 35.4)


NOTE: The city of Voorhees CDP (Somerset County), New Jersey does not have FBI Crime Statistics. The closest similar sized city with FBI crime data is the city of Milltown, New Jersey.
